Cafe Francais is Tucson’s answer to
where to find the most authentic
French cuisine & pastries.
Come in and enjoy our diverse menu,
including items such as Mediterranean
Eggs, Croque Monsieur, Homemade
Quiches, Dove Sole Meuniere, Canard
A l’Orange or Frog Legs Provencal.

And don’t miss the Sunday Brunch!